you need a mech cutout first.. an electric cutout is is just a cover to a mech one that flips a blade open like a TB. they are 25 bucks figure it in to the cost and you can get both of them from summit or jegs.
watchout for the rear wastegate, you install it before the rear manifold pipe. the exhaust will take the path of least resistance and only flow to the crossover..(not good) the wastegate will not regulate anything then
